        public void GetSignal()
        {
            // create the interface
            AllJoyn.InterfaceDescription testIntf = null;
            status = bus.CreateInterface(INTERFACE_NAME, out testIntf);
            Assert.Equal(AllJoyn.QStatus.OK, status);
            Assert.NotNull(testIntf);
            Assert.Equal(AllJoyn.QStatus.OK, testIntf.AddMethod("foo", "", "", ""));
            status = testIntf.AddSignal("chirp", "s", "data", AllJoyn.InterfaceDescription.AnnotationFlags.Default);
            Assert.Equal(AllJoyn.QStatus.OK, status);

            // Verify the signal
            AllJoyn.InterfaceDescription.Member signalMember = null;
            signalMember = testIntf.GetSignal("chirp");
            Assert.NotNull(signalMember);

            Assert.Equal(testIntf, signalMember.Iface);
            Assert.Equal(AllJoyn.Message.Type.Signal, signalMember.MemberType);
            Assert.Equal("chirp", signalMember.Name);
            Assert.Equal("s", signalMember.Signature);
            Assert.Equal("", signalMember.ReturnSignature);
            Assert.Equal("data", signalMember.ArgNames);

            AllJoyn.InterfaceDescription.Member methodMember = null;
            methodMember = testIntf.GetSignal("foo");
            //since "foo" is a method GetSignal should return null
            Assert.Null(methodMember);

            methodMember = testIntf.GetSignal("bar");
            // "bar" is not a member of the interface it should return null
            Assert.Null(methodMember);
        }

        public void GetMethod()
        {
            // create the interface
            AllJoyn.InterfaceDescription testIntf = null;
            status = bus.CreateInterface(INTERFACE_NAME, out testIntf);
            Assert.Equal(AllJoyn.QStatus.OK, status);
            Assert.NotNull(testIntf);

            // Test adding a MethodCall
            Assert.Equal(AllJoyn.QStatus.OK, testIntf.AddMethod("ping", "s", "s", "in,out"));
            Assert.Equal(AllJoyn.QStatus.OK, testIntf.AddSignal("foo", "", ""));

            // Verify the ping member
            AllJoyn.InterfaceDescription.Member pingMember = null;
            pingMember = testIntf.GetMethod("ping");
            Assert.NotNull(pingMember);

            Assert.Equal(testIntf, pingMember.Iface);
            Assert.Equal(AllJoyn.Message.Type.MethodCall, pingMember.MemberType);
            Assert.Equal("ping", pingMember.Name);
            Assert.Equal("s", pingMember.Signature);
            Assert.Equal("s", pingMember.ReturnSignature);
            Assert.Equal("in,out", pingMember.ArgNames);

            AllJoyn.InterfaceDescription.Member fooMember = null;
            fooMember = testIntf.GetMethod("foo");
            // since "foo" is a signal is should return null when using GetMethod
            Assert.Null(fooMember);

            fooMember = testIntf.GetMethod("bar");
            // since "bar" is not a member of the interface it should be null
            Assert.Null(fooMember);
        }

        public void srp_keyx2()
        {
            ResetAuthFlags();
            clientBus.ClearKeyStore();

            SrpKeyx2_service_authlistener serviceAuthlistener = new SrpKeyx2_service_authlistener(this);

            Assert.Equal(AllJoyn.QStatus.OK, serviceBus.EnablePeerSecurity("ALLJOYN_SRP_KEYX", serviceAuthlistener, null, false));

            serviceBus.ClearKeyStore();

            Assert.Equal(AllJoyn.QStatus.OK, SetUpAuthService());

            SrpKeyx2_client_authlistener clientAuthlistener = new SrpKeyx2_client_authlistener(this);

            Assert.Equal(AllJoyn.QStatus.OK, clientBus.EnablePeerSecurity("ALLJOYN_SRP_KEYX", clientAuthlistener, null, false));
            clientBus.ClearKeyStore();

            // create+activate the interface
            AllJoyn.QStatus status;
            AllJoyn.InterfaceDescription iFace = null;
            Assert.Equal(AllJoyn.QStatus.OK, clientBus.CreateInterface(INTERFACE_NAME, AllJoyn.InterfaceDescription.SecurityPolicy.Required, out iFace));
            Assert.NotNull(iFace);

            Assert.Equal(AllJoyn.QStatus.OK, iFace.AddMethod("ping", "s", "s", "in,out"));
            iFace.Activate();

            AllJoyn.ProxyBusObject proxyBusObject = new AllJoyn.ProxyBusObject(clientBus, WELLKNOWN_NAME, OBJECT_PATH, 0);
            Assert.NotNull(proxyBusObject);
            Assert.Equal(AllJoyn.QStatus.OK, proxyBusObject.AddInterface(iFace));

            AllJoyn.MsgArg  input    = new AllJoyn.MsgArg("s", "AllJoyn");
            AllJoyn.Message replyMsg = new AllJoyn.Message(clientBus);
            status = proxyBusObject.MethodCall(INTERFACE_NAME, "ping", input, replyMsg, 5000, 0);
            Assert.Equal(AllJoyn.QStatus.BUS_REPLY_IS_ERROR_MESSAGE, status);

            Assert.True(authflags.requestCreds_service);
            Assert.True(authflags.authComplete_serivce);

            Assert.True(authflags.authComplete_client);
            // Authentication complete can occure before the SecurityViolation callback
            // with authentication complete the MethodCall will return the BUS_REPLY_IS_ERROR_MESSAGE
            // and the code could check for the sercurityViolation_client before it is actually set
            // for this reason we need to wait for the flag to be set.
            Wait(TimeSpan.FromSeconds(5));
            Assert.True(authflags.securityViolation_client);
            clientAuthlistener.Dispose();
            serviceAuthlistener.Dispose();

            busObject.Dispose();

            proxyBusObject.Dispose();
        }
